The Web Content Specialist supports the Web Manager in content development from concept through production and delivery. The position is responsible for assessing content opportunities, quality of content deliverables, and recommending content strategies that meet the university’s strategic goals and deliver excellent user experience. The Web Content Specialist will serve as the key liaison with other university communications staff, department heads and content managers in developing and managing the Content Management System ( CMS ). The position will support the timely, relevant, and current content for university’s public web presence to advance the university’s marketing communications strategies. The Web Content Specialist is involved with design, development, testing, implementation and enhancements to the university websites.
